Throwback to the first song I could halfway play on drums—in my basement, 2014. I bought a no‑name kit on Amazon for $250, had never played before, and I’ll admit: I’m impatient. Rudiments? Meh. I just wanted to play a song. (And especially a song from my teenage years in the 80's).
It was AC/DC’s “Back in Black.” I found the score, downloaded the track onto my 1st‑gen iPad, put on headphones, and went to work. I was so frustrated not getting the groove—but the more I practiced, the closer it clicked. Late October, maybe mid‑November, I finally played it half decently all the way through. Felt like unlocking a secret language.

For those who don’t know: a basic groove is just kick (foot), snare (hand), and hi-hat (hand) working together. When they line up, it’s pure joy—even if your drum kit is cheap and sounds like the drumming in Tarzan.
